What Exactly Is a Roofing Emergency?

Not every roof problem needs a midnight call. But some absolutely do. An emergency roof repair is a service to stop immediate, ongoing damage to your home’s interior and structure. The key is stabilization.

Think of it like a trip to the emergency room for your house. The doctor’s first job is to stop the bleeding, not perform the full surgery. For roofs, that first job is almost always emergency roof tarping—securing a heavy-duty waterproof cover over the damaged area to keep rain, snow, and wind out. This is a temporary fix to protect your belongings and drywall until permanent repairs can be scheduled.

When Should You Call an Emergency Roofer in New Albany?

Call a pro immediately if you see:

  • Active water pouring into your home (not just a slow drip).
  • A large section of roof is missing or collapsed after a storm.
  • You have severe wind damage with shingles torn off in multiple spots.
  • A tree or large limb has punctured your roof.
  • You notice new, significant sagging in your ceiling or roofline.

How New Albany’s Climate Wears on Your Roof

Our Ohio weather puts roofs to the test. Hot, humid summers can bake asphalt shingles, making them brittle. Our cold winters bring the risk of ice dams along your eaves, especially on older colonials in the Bevelhymer area where attic insulation might be older. When melting snow refreezes at the roof’s edge, it can force water back up under the shingles and into your home.

Most homes here have asphalt shingle roofs, which last 15-25 years. Some historic properties or newer custom builds might have metal or tile. Each material reacts differently to our storms. Knowing your roof type helps you understand its weak points.

What Does Emergency Roofing Cost in New Albany?

We believe in clear, upfront pricing. Emergency services often include a few parts:

  • Call-Out / Dispatch Fee: This covers the immediate response, travel, and initial assessment. For our local New Albany service area, this typically ranges from $150-$300, depending on time of day.
  • Emergency Tarping Cost: This is usually priced by the square foot of coverage needed, plus labor. For a standard section, you might expect between $300 and $800. The goal is to make the area watertight.
  • After-Hours Premium: Services between 7 PM and 7 AM or on major holidays may have a higher labor rate.

The good news? If the damage is from a covered event like a storm, your homeowner’s insurance will often cover these stabilization costs. We work with you to document the damage thoroughly for your claim.

Your Safety-First Checklist While Waiting for Help

DO:

  1. Move furniture, rugs, and electronics away from the leak.
  2. Place buckets or bins to catch water.
  3. Mop up standing water to prevent slips and floor damage.
  4. Turn off electricity in the affected area if water is near fixtures or wires.
  5. Take clear photos and videos of the damage for insurance.

DO NOT:

  1. Do not climb onto a damaged or wet roof. It is extremely dangerous. Let the professionals handle it.
  2. Avoid poking the ceiling sag with a broomstick—it could collapse.
  3. Don’t try to make permanent repairs yourself. Focus on safety and damage control.

New Albany Permits and the Repair Process

For most emergency tarping and minor repairs, no permit is needed right away. However, once we move to permanent storm damage roof repair or a full replacement, the City of New Albany requires a building permit. Our team handles this for you. An inspection will follow to ensure the work meets Ohio building codes, which is especially important for historic district homes.

If the damage is severe, we may recommend a structural engineer’s assessment before any permanent work begins. We coordinate with your insurance adjuster to streamline the entire process.
